签名
AndroidStudiorunapp调试时添加签名的配置
AndroidStudiorunapp调试时添加签名的配置android studio提供了可视化的页⾯来设置⾃定义的签名。打开File-->Project Structure-->选择moudle下的要配置的⼯程,如下图所⽰,配置完成后保存。android获取真正的签名2、接着配置编译时使⽤⾃定义签名。 不同版本的as设置稍有不同,⾃⼰观察⼀下界⾯即可...
修改Android签名证书keystore的密码、别名alias以及别名密码
修改Android签名证书keystore的密码、别名alias以及别名密码Eclipse ADT的Custom debug keystore⾃定义调试证书的时候,Android应⽤开发接⼊各种SDK时会发现,有很多SDK是需要靠package name和keystore的指纹hash来识别的(百度地图SDK、⼜或是sdk、新浪微博的sdk),这样如果使⽤默认⾃动⽣成的debug keysto...
Android生成支付二维码URL
Android⽣成⽀付⼆维码URL ⽣成⽀付⼆维码URL,让别⼈扫⼀扫收钱,就是的收钱码/***⼆维码⽀付**/public class WXPayUtils {private static String strResponse = null;private static String url = "";public static String nonceStr = "";publ...
Androidapk二次打包,重新签名
二次打包,重新签名 利用标准的java工具(位于jdk\jre\bin目录下)key,利用工具使用生成的key来生成证书(位于jdk\bin目录下)。Win +R 运行cmd,进D:\temp(注:使用该目录为示例工作目录)a)、创建 keytool -genkey -alias demo.keystore 说明:工具是Java JD...
Android6.0更新包与已安装应用的签名不一致
Android6.0更新包与已安装应⽤的签名不⼀致1、异常应⽤已从桌⾯卸载,应⽤管理中也不到此应⽤更新包与已安装应⽤的签名不⼀致2、原因未卸载⼲净3、解决⽅法3.1 确认连接到设备adb devices3.2 卸载adb uninstall xxxxxx为包名。android获取真正的签名3.3 查看包名_⾮必须adb shell pm list packages更多。...
androidstudio签名打包详解
androidstudio签名打包详解Debug 和Release 的区别Debug 通常称为调试版本,它包含调试信息,并且不作任何优化,便于程序员调试程序。Release 称为发布版本,它往往是进⾏了各种优化,使得程序在代码⼤⼩和运⾏速度上都是最优的,以便⽤户很好地使⽤。本质区别实际上,Debug 和 Release 并没有本质的界限,他们只是⼀组编译选项的集合,编译器只是按照预定的选项⾏动。事...
Android签名包调试问题
Android签名包调试问题签名1.打包带签名的包时会有个V1,V2的签名选择,只签名V2的话会导致有些设备或者模拟器⽆法安装,且⽆法查看apk的证书adle签名配置signingConfigs {release {if(project.hasProperty("RELEASE_STORE_FILE")){storeFile file(RELEASE_STORE_FILE...
Androidapp平台签名方法
Androidapp平台签名⽅法1、使⽤源码编译将编译出的apk放到源码中进⾏platform签名android获取真正的签名2、使⽤signapk.jar签名之前查看资料也是说,将平台的platform.x509.pem、platform.pk8、signapk.jar三个⽂件拷贝到⼀个⽂件夹下,再将Android studio 编译出的apk也放到此⽂件夹下,使⽤如下命令签名:java -Xm...
Androidjni加密
Androidjni加密我们经常会有些敏感的信息需要客户端加解密,但android很容易被反编译,所以我们写在客户端⾥的密钥终究得不到安全,可能有⼈会想把加密⽅式写在C代码中,⽣成.so供APK使⽤,可是别⼈不关⼼你C⾥的代码,直接把你的so⽂件给拿去⽤就可以了,那么有没有⼀种安全的措施来加⼤难度呢,我说⼀下我们项⽬中如果解决客户端加密安全⽅案.⾸先加密的代码仍然写在C代码中,⾄少C被反编译出来是...
Android授权登录新浪微博获取用户个人信息汇总
Android授权登录新浪微博获取用户个人信息一、准备工作我们都知道,无论是分享到新浪微博,还是获取新浪微博的用户信息,都离不开一样东西,那就是新浪微博的APPID,APPID通过绑定我们应用程序的包名和签名进行识别,可以说它是我们跟新浪微博官方所提供接口进行交互的一个重要令牌,这一点跟QQ、接口等访问原理基本是一样的。那么问题来了,APPID到底怎么得到?答案就是你要到新浪微博开放平台htt...
AndroidStudio安全管理签名文件keystroe和签名密码(星空武哥)_百度文 ...
AndroidStudio安全管理签名⽂件keystroe和签名密码(星空武哥)AndroidStudio由于使⽤了gradle的进⾏项⽬构建,使我们开发app⽅便很多,今天我就给⼤家列出⼏点是⽤gradle的⽅便之处。android获取真正的签名⼀、⼆、三、我们在使⽤AndroidStudio进⾏release版的apk签名的时候,往往都是将签名⽂件keystore放在项⽬中,密码写在build...
Android签名打包
Android签名打包什么是签名?Android 要求所有已安装的应⽤程序都使⽤数字证书做数字签名,数字证书的私钥由开发者持有。Android 使⽤证书作为标识应⽤程序作者的⼀种⽅式,证书不需要由证书认证中⼼签名,使⽤⾃制签名证书。Android 系统不会安装或运⾏没有正确签名的应⽤,此规则适⽤于任何地⽅运⾏的Android系统。因此在真机或模拟器上运⾏或者调试应⽤前,必须为其设置好签名。两种签名...
Android对Apk签名的两种方法
Android对Apk签名的两种⽅法使⽤Android Studio签名1. 选择主菜单 "Build" --> "Generate "Markdown2. 弹出如下窗⼝Markdown3. 点击 "",按要求填写信息,然后点击 "OK"Markdown 4. 弹出如下界⾯,点击 "next"Markdown 5. 弹出如下界⾯,点击 "f...
Android之Keystore生成、Apk签名
Android之Keystore⽣成、Apk签名在中,⼀个项⽬完成后,我们要得到它的Apk往往有⼏种形式:(1)直接从⼯程的bin⽬录下复制出来,安装(2)通过AndroidTools或者指令的形式对Apk进⾏签名导出那么,我们为什么需要对Apk进⾏签名,⼜怎么对Apk进⾏签名?我们来了解⼀下....⼀、签名的意义每⼀个Android的应⽤程序都要有⼀个唯⼀辨识的ID,签名的作⽤就是给我们的Apk...
Android使用AndroidStudio+Gradle或命令行进行apk签名打包
Android使⽤AndroidStudio+Gradle或命令⾏进⾏apk签名打包默认为debug mode,使⽤的签名⽂件在: $HOME/.android/debug.keystore⽐如 C:\Users\chengcj1\.android\debug.keystore1.利⽤Gradle命令⾏进⾏签名a. Release Mode 签名:adle:signingConfi...
支付签名java_Java中的支付APIV3版本签名的案例
⽀付签名java_Java中的⽀付APIV3版本签名的案例Java中的⽀付API V3版本签名的案例发布时间:2020-10-29 10:03:01来源:亿速云阅读:95作者:⼩新这篇⽂章给⼤家分享的是有关Java中的⽀付API V3版本签名的案例的内容。⼩编觉得挺实⽤的,因此分享给⼤家做个参考。⼀起跟随⼩编过来看看吧。java基础教程栏⽬介绍Java中的⽀付,实现API V3...
Android敏感API的说明
Android敏感API的说明 从中国的国情来看,Google 的诸多产品,包括 gmail,Android 官⽅市场 Google Play 正处于并将长期处于访问不了的状态。国内⼏亿⽹民也要⽣活,于是墙内出现了“百家争鸣”的场⾯,各家硬件⼚商、三⼤运营商和游戏应⽤商城都推出了⾃⼰的Android市场,出现了豌⾖荚,91助⼿,MIUI 应⽤商店、360⼿机助⼿、搜狗⼿机助⼿、酷安⽹等...
android 防止 进程注入原理
android 防止 进程注入原理Android系统中的进程注入主要是指恶意程序将自己注入到其他正常进程中,从而获取对目标进程的控制权。为了防止进程注入,Android系统采取了以下几种原理:1. Linux用户和组权限:Android系统是基于Linux内核的,进程注入需要具备足够的权限才能够实现。Android系统通过严格控制应用的用户和组权限,限制了恶意程序对其他进程的注入能力。2. 安全沙...
java 获取method signatrue
java 获取method signatrue如何在Java中获取方法的签名(signature)。在Java开发中,方法的签名(signature)是指方法的名称、参数类型和返回类型的组合。它是用来区分不同方法的重要标识。在某些情况下,我们需要获取方法的签名来进行一些特定的操作,比如反射、动态代理等。本文将一步一步地回答如何在Java中获取方法的签名。一、什么是方法的签名(signature)在...
Android百度地图API开发
最近自己想研究下地图,本来想研究google Map,但是申请API key比较坑爹,于是从百度地图入手,其实他们的用法都差不多,本篇文章就带领大家在自己的Android项目中加入百度地图的功能,接下来我会写一系列关于百度地图的文章,欢迎大家到时候关注!一 申请API key∙ 在使用百度地图之前,我们必须去申请一个百度地图的API key,申请地址lbsyun.baidu/...
如何让应用程序获取system权限、root权限
如何让应⽤程序获取system权限、root权限 获取system权限 上⼀篇随笔简单介绍了下Android权限的⼀些规则,我们发现很多事如果没有system权限基本上⽆法完成,那么如何让⾃⼰的应⽤获取system权限呢? ⼀般情况下,设定apk的权限,可在l中添加android:sharedUserId="an...
Android里Apk的证书指纹作用
Android⾥Apk的证书指纹作⽤前⾔:android获取真正的签名私钥签名介绍:APK应⽤发布时候都要进⾏签名。⽣成签名证书:通过JDK的Keytool⼯具以及签名⽂件jks(java key store),导出SHA256指纹。jks⾥就可理解成证书(包含公钥)。证书指纹是证书摘要。hash不可逆。该证书指纹要配置在apk集成的第三⽅应⽤的平台上。发布apk后,平台可通过apk获取指纹。可对...
android反编译apk,webview拦截url,替换图片资源,重新签名打包apk
android反编译apk,webview拦截url,替换图⽚资源,重新签名打包apk反编译apk,webview拦截url,替换图⽚资源,重新签名打包apk接到⼀个需求:对游戏中的⼀个图⽚logo进⾏拦截替换问题点:项⽬⼯程丢失,只有apk包解决前准备⼯具:1.apktool:反编译apk,apk重新打包;2.Java2smail (android studio插件):将修改的Java代码编译成...
android 打包规则
android 打包规则Android 应用程序的打包规则主要涉及到 Android 应用程序项目的目录结构、Gradle 构建脚本、签名配置等方面。以下是 Android 应用程序打包的一般规则:1. 目录结构: - Android 应用程序通常遵循一定的目录结构,其中包含 `src`、`res`、`assets` 等目录。 - `src` 目录包含 Java 源代码...
typescript 反射方法的签名
题目:TypeScript 反射方法的签名内容:1. TypeScript是一种由微软开发的开源编程语言,它是JavaScript的超集,通过添加静态类型,增加了代码的可读性和可维护性。在TypeScript中,反射是指在运行时获取类型信息和对象结构的能力,而方法签名则是方法的声明和使用方式。2. TypeScript 中的反射机制通过`typeof`和`instanceof`等关键字实现,可以在...
javaapk签名_用java命令重新签名apk
javaapk签名_⽤java命令重新签名apkapk简介APK是AndroidPackage的缩写,即Android安装包(apk)。APK是类似Symbian Sis或Sisx的⽂件格式。通过将APK⽂件直接传到Android模拟器或Android⼿机中执⾏即可安装。apk⽂件和sis⼀样,把android sdk编译的⼯程打包成⼀个安装程序⽂件,格式为apk。APK⽂件其实是zip格式,但后...
Android权限的一些细节
Android权限的⼀些细节Android 权限的⼀些细节1 哪些app属于system app?为了区分privilege app和system app,这⾥先说明system app是什么,避免之后的讨论概念混乱。在PackageManagerService中对是否是system app的判断:具有ApplicationInfo.FLAG_SYSTEM标记的,被视为System app。1pr...
Android获取SHA1的方法
Android获取SHA1的⽅法某些Google Play服务(例如Google登录和App Invites)要求我们提供签名证书的SHA-1,以便google paly为我们的应⽤创建OAuth2客户端和API密钥。那么如何获取SHA-1呢?获取SHA-1有多种⽅法,这⾥我们介绍⽤命令⾏的⽅法。(使⽤keytool,注意,keytool是jdk的⼯具,所以要先设置好jdk的环境变量)SHA-1分...
Android安全机制
1 Android 安全机制概述Android 是一个权限分离的系统 。 这是利用 Linux 已有的权限管理机制,通过为每一个 Application 分配不同的 uid 和 gid , 从而使得不同的 Application 之间的私有数据和访问( native 以及 java 层通过这种 sandbox 机制,都可以)达到隔离的目的 。 与此 同时, Android 还 在此基础上进行扩展,...
如何获取android项目的SHA1值与PackageName
如何获取android项⽬的SHA1值与PackageName获取应⽤包名PackageNameEclipse打开Android 应⽤⼯程的l配置⽂件,package 属性所对应的内容为应⽤PackageName。Android Studio获取adle⽂件中的ApplicationId作为PackageName;如果没有设置Applicatio...